What functions are performed by Memory Management of Operating System?
What functions are performed by memory management system.
Advertisements
उत्तर
In general, the memory management modules perform the following functions:
- To keep track of all memory addresses that are either free or allocated, as well as which processes are allocated and how much.
- To determine the memory allocation policy, i.e., which process should receive how much memory when and where.
- To allocate and deallocate memory addresses using various techniques and algorithms. Normally, this is accomplished with special gear.
